Navigating Technical Challenges and Limitations

However, no design is perfect for every situation, and a responsible review must address where Senior 2022 Graduation Celebration might struggle. The primary constraint lies in hoop size and fabric type. If you are working with a small hoop, such as those used for socks or narrow cap fronts, you need to be careful. While the design looks clean, if it contains intricate details or tiny lettering, shrinking it down to fit a two-inch hoop could result in a muddy mess where the threads merge together.

Fabric texture is another critical factor. On stretchy knits like standard t-shirts, any dense fill stitch can cause the fabric to pucker if the stabilizer isn't adequate. I would advise testing this design on a scrap piece of the same material before running a full production run. Thin, sheer fabrics are likely out of bounds; the tension required to hold the stitches might tear the material. Similarly, while it works well on structured items like caps, the curvature of a hat can distort straight lines. You must account for the way the fabric stretches over the dome of the head when positioning the design.

Dense stitch areas require extra attention to thread quality. If the design includes large blocks of color, using cheap polyester thread might lead to breakage or lint buildup in your machine. Conversely, on dark fabrics, ensure your thread colors have sufficient opacity. A light pastel thread might get swallowed by a navy blue shirt, diminishing the impact of the graduation theme. Always check the stitch density specifications if available, or test it yourself to see how much coverage is needed.

Design Notes for Professional Results

Before you commit to a batch of commercial embroidery projects, there are several practical steps to ensure success. First, always run a test on scrap fabric. This allows you to dial in the tension and see exactly how the stitch density interacts with your specific fabric choice. Second, inspect the small details closely. Sometimes, what looks good on a monitor loses definition when stitched. Look for any tiny corners or thin lines that might disappear or become jagged.

Thread color selection is paramount for brand consistency. If you are selling these items as part of a boutique line, choose threads that align with your brand palette. A mismatched thread color can make a professional-looking design appear amateurish. Additionally, confirm whether the file includes proper layering instructions if you plan to use multiple colors. If you are using a multi-color setup, ensure your machine is calibrated correctly to avoid misalignment.

Don't forget to check the licensing terms. Even though the product description mentions compatibility with Cricut Design Space and Silhouette, you need to verify if you have the right to sell finished items made from this design. Many digital product sellers overlook this, leading to legal issues down the road. Also, consider testing the design in black and white mockups. This helps you visualize the silhouette and composition without the distraction of color, ensuring the layout holds up under different lighting conditions.
